Fabrice Raineri, co-founder of NcodiN and a recognized pioneer in indium phosphide (InP) nanolasers integrated directly on silicon, has been appointed full-time Chief Technical Officer of the Paris-region startup. The company, which aims to boost the performance of AI chips through advanced optical interconnects, announced the move, elevating Raineri from his previous director-level role—likely part-time—to lead its technical strategy entirely.
NcodiN is developing photonic interconnects that address the data transfer bottlenecks plaguing large-scale AI processors. Its core innovation lies in embedding nanolasers onto silicon photonics platforms, a field where Raineri’s academic work at institutions like C2N (Centre for Nanosciences and Nanotechnology) and Université Paris Cité has been groundbreaking. His full-time commitment signals a maturation push, transitioning the technology from lab to market-ready solutions for chipmakers.
The appointment consolidates Raineri’s direct oversight of R&D, with the startup betting that his deep expertise will accelerate the commercialization of energy-efficient, high-bandwidth optical links that are critical for next-generation AI hardware.
